By Type:The market is segmented into Return Management Solutions, Inventory Management Systems, Analytics Software, Recall Returns Analytics, Repairable Returns Analytics, End-of-Use Returns Analytics, End-of-Life Returns Analytics, Consulting Services, and Others. Each of these subsegments is integral to improving the efficiency, traceability, and sustainability of reverse logistics operations. Return Management Solutions and Inventory Management Systems are particularly critical for handling high volumes of returns in e-commerce and retail, while Analytics Software and Recall Returns Analytics support data-driven decision-making and regulatory compliance. Consulting Services assist organizations in designing and implementing tailored reverse logistics strategies .

By End-User:The end-user segmentation includes Retail, E-commerce, Manufacturing, Consumer Electronics, Automotive, Pharmaceuticals, and Others. Retail and E-commerce sectors are the leading adopters of reverse logistics analytics due to the high volume of product returns and the need for efficient return processing. Manufacturing and Automotive sectors utilize analytics to manage recalls, repairs, and end-of-life product flows, while Consumer Electronics and Pharmaceuticals focus on compliance, traceability, and sustainability in their reverse logistics operations .

The future of the France reverse logistics analytics market appears promising, driven by the increasing emphasis on sustainability and technological integration. As companies strive to enhance operational efficiency, the adoption of real-time analytics and AI-driven solutions will likely become standard practice. Furthermore, the growing consumer demand for seamless return experiences will push businesses to innovate their logistics strategies, ensuring they remain competitive in an evolving marketplace focused on environmental responsibility and customer satisfaction.
